Join us on this meaningful journey where your skills, compassion and dedication will make a remarkable difference in the lives of those we serve.How youll contributeA Registered Nurse (RN) who excels in this role:Provides direct patient care using the nursing process in accordance with applicable scope and standards of practice.Records all pertinent data on patients medical record accurately, clearly and conciselyAlways assures the safety and privacy of patientsDemonstrates accurate interpretation and documentation of fetal monitor tracingSafely & successfully places fetal scalp electrode when need identified and appropriateDemonstrates skills needed to safely and efficiently prepare patient for C-sectionDemonstrates understanding of physician orders for postpartum patientsIdentifies changing patient needs and alters nursing care appropriatelyVerbalizes and demonstrates understanding of epidural anesthesia protocolDemonstrates effectiveness in assisting during vaginal delivery, including vacuum or forceps deliveryAssists appropriately with newborn care at deliveryPerforms plan of care intervention, including medication administration, specimen collection, clinical treatments, as well as other medical care treatmentMonitors, records, and communicates patient condition as appropriate to care team, physician, patient, and family.Assists patients with performing activities of daily living, including personal hygiene, elimination, nutrition, and ambulation.Collaborates as needed across disciplines to coordinate patient care, including patient transfer, discharge, referral and spiritual/psychosocial support needs.Evaluates learning needs of patient and/or family and provides patient/family education appropriate to age, culture, condition, and circumstances.Works as an advocate for the physical and emotional well-being of the patient.Why join usWe believe that investing in our employees is the first step to providing excellent patient care. Additional requirements include:Experience: One year of obstetrical clinical experience preferredSkills: Requires critical thinking skills, decisive judgment and the ability to work with minimal supervision. Must be able to work in a stressful environment and take appropriate actionAmerican Heart Association Certifications:Basic Life Support (BLS) within 30-days of hireAdvanced Cardiovascular Life Support (ACLS) within 90-days of hireNeonatal Resuscitation Provider (NRP-Advanced) within 90-day of hireAdditional Certifications:Intermediate Fetal Monitoring Certificate (FMC) within 6 months of hireRequired for Charge Nurses only Advanced Fetal Monitoring (AFM) within 1 year of hire or transfer into charge position. In the event that the employee holds an instructor certification, the instructor certification is allowed.STABLE course to be completed within 90-days of hire, and maintained thereafterConnect with a Recruiter: Not ready to complete an application, or have questions Please contact Tara by emailing .More about Northeastern Nevada Regional HospitalNortheastern Nevada Regional Hospital is a 75-bed acute care hospital that offers exceptional care to Elko county and the surrounding areas of northeastern Nevada.
